About the area
Fernandina Beach, nestled on Amelia Island in Northeast Florida, is a charming coastal town that beckons travelers with its picturesque landscapes, rich history, and laid-back atmosphere. This quaint destination is a treasure trove of experiences, perfect for those seeking a blend of relaxation and adventure.
The town's historic district is a delightful journey through time, with a tapestry of Victorian-era architecture and cobblestone streets. Visitors can explore a variety of unique shops, local art galleries, and cozy eateries that add to the town's old-world charm. The Amelia Island Museum of History offers a deeper dive into the area's past, showcasing its fascinating timeline from Native American settlements to its era as a bustling seaport.
Fernandina Beach is renowned for its pristine beaches, which stretch for miles along the Atlantic coast. Main Beach Park is a popular spot, providing not only sun-soaked relaxation but also amenities such as playgrounds, picnic areas, and volleyball courts. For those who prefer a more secluded environment, the beaches at Fort Clinch State Park offer a serene escape, along with the chance to explore a well-preserved 19th-century fort.
Nature enthusiasts will find plenty to explore, from kayaking through the tranquil marshes to embarking on guided eco-tours that reveal the island's diverse wildlife, including sea turtles, dolphins, and a myriad of bird species. The island's maritime forests and saltwater estuaries are a haven for out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and fishing.
Golfers are drawn to Fernandina Beach for its world-class golf courses, which provide challenging play amidst stunning coastal backdrops. The island's mild climate allows for year-round golfing, making it an ideal destination for those looking to hit the links.
Culinary adventurers will savor the local flavors of Fernandina Beach, where fresh seafood is a staple. The town's restaurants range from casual beachside shacks serving up the day's catch to fine dining establishments offering gourmet interpretations of Southern cuisine. The annual Isle of Eight Flags Shrimp Festival celebrates this culinary heritage with a weekend of food, art, and entertainment.
